Condividi tramite


Procedura: installare un assembly nella Global Assembly Cache

Aggiornamento: novembre 2007

Esistono quattro modi per installare un assembly nella Global Assembly Cache:

  • Utilizzo dello strumento Global Assembly Cache (Gacutil.exe).

    È possibile utilizzare Gacutil.exe per aggiungere assembly con nome sicuro alla Global Assembly Cache e visualizzare il contenuto di tale cache.

    Nota:

    È necessario utilizzare Gacutil.exe solo in fase di sviluppo e non se ne consiglia l'utilizzo per l'installazione di assembly di produzione nella Global Assembly Cache.

  • Utilizzo di Microsoft Windows Installer 2.0.

    Si tratta della modalità consigliata e più comune per l'aggiunta di assembly alla Global Assembly Cache. In tal modo si ottiene il conteggio dei riferimenti degli assembly nella Global Assembly Cache e altre utili funzionalità.

  • Utilizzo di un'estensione della shell di Windows inclusa in Windows Software Development Kit (SDK), denominata Visualizzatore Assembly Cache (Shfusion.dll).

    Questa estensione consente di trascinare gli assembly nella Global Assembly Cache.

  • Utilizzo dello Strumento .NET Framework Configuration (Mscorcfg.msc).

    Lo Strumento .NET Framework Configuration (Mscorcfg.msc) consente di visualizzare la Global Assembly Cache e aggiungere nuovi assembly alla cache.

Per installare un assembly con nome sicuro nella Global Assembly Cache mediante lo strumento Global Assembly Cache (Gacutil.exe)

  • Al prompt dei comandi digitare il comando seguente:

    gacutil –I <nome assembly>

    In questo comando nome assembly rappresenta il nome dell'assembly da installare nella Global Assembly Cache.

L'esempio seguente consente di installare un assembly con nome file hello.dll nella Global Assembly Cache.

gacutil -i hello.dll

Vedere anche

Riferimenti

Strumento Global Assembly Cache (Gacutil.exe)

Visualizzatore Assembly Cache (Shfusion.dll)

Altre risorse

Utilizzo di assembly e della Global Assembly Cache